Microeconomics eco 3101 study guide: analysis describing relationships of cause and effect: positive analysis. 2. analysis examining questions of what ought to be: normative analysis. 3. microeconomics deals with the behavior of small/single/individual economic actors: microeconomics. 4. in a _________ ________ prices are determined by the interaction of consumers, workers, and firms: market economy. 5. the collection of buyers and sellers that, through their actual and potential interactions, determine the price of a product or the set of the product: market. 6. boundaries of a market, both geographical and in terms of the range of products produced and sold within it: extent of a market. No single buyer or seller has a significant impact on the price. 8. price prevailing in a competitive market: market price. 9. relationship between the quantity of a good that producers are willing to sell and the price of the good. 10. relationship between the quantity of a good that consumers are willing to buy and the price of the good.
